Cast iron bathtubs are known for their durability and longevity, as they are resistant to scratches and dents. They require minimal maintenance and are easy to clean. However, they are heavier and more expensive than steel bathtubs. Steel bathtubs are lighter and more affordable, but they are not as durable and may require more maintenance to prevent rust and scratches.
